<p>Use Hashids to generate short obfuscated strings from IDs. Useful for URL shorteners and human friendly IDs: </p>
https://pypi.python.org/pypi/django-hashid-field
Open link
Felipe Farias
Posted on
December 27, 2016
Topics:
django, python
Tech Insights
Lessons we’ve learned while working on real projects
accessibility
agile
ai
api
architecture
aws
career
celery
communication
concurrency
css
data
database
db
debug
design
design system
development
devops
django
docker
documentation
figma
frontend
git
html
javascript
js
leadership
management
metrics
ml
orm
performance
postgres
process
product
product design
python
react
redux
research
security
software
sql
sre
test
testing
tests
typescript
ui
ux
web
workflow
<p>Arrow Functions: How, Why, When (and WHEN NOT) to Use Them </p>
↗
https://zendev.com/2018/10/01/javascript-arrow-functions-how-why-when.html
Mariane Pastor
Jun 28, 2019
Topics:
js
<p>One simple trick to optimize React re-renders: </p>
↗
https://kentcdodds.com/blog/optimize-react-re-renders
Rebeca Sarai
Jun 28, 2019
Topics:
js, react
<p>Is it a good practice to use try-except-else in Python? </p>
↗
https://stackoverflow.com/a/16138864
Filipe Ximenes
Jun 28, 2019
Topics:
python
<p>How a UI process can help you get the right client feedback at the right time </p>
↗
https://link.medium.com/2qm1lBTwRX
Pedro Bacelar
Jun 27, 2019
Topics:
design process, ui, ux
<p>The Optimal Placement for Mobile Call to Action Buttons </p>
↗
https://uxmovement.com/mobile/the-optimal-placement-for-mobile-call-to-action-buttons/
Pedro Bacelar
Jun 27, 2019
Topics:
mobile, ui, ux
<p>How To Fix The Tech Hiring </p>
↗
https://medium.com/@fagnerbrack/how-to-fix-the-tech-hiring-f56ae8192d8c
João Lins
Jun 27, 2019
Topics:
hiring
<p>Architecture and Design InfoQ Trends Report</p>
↗
https://www.infoq.com/articles/architecture-trends-2019/
Felipe Farias
Jun 27, 2019
Topics:
architecture, reports
<p>VS Code can't resolve your Django imports anymore? Try this: #issuecomment-463789294</p>
↗
https://github.com/Microsoft/vscode-python/issues/3840
Luca Bezerra
Jun 27, 2019
Topics:
django, ide, vs code
<p>Nice pomodoro tool in the terminal writen in Python </p>
↗
https://github.com/JaDogg/pydoro
Gustavo Carvalho
Jun 27, 2019
Topics:
python
<p>how tooltips can improve feature discovery </p>
↗
https://uxdesign.cc/tooltips-your-secret-weapon-for-improving-deature-discovery-e1c380562f2e
Aline Silveira
Jun 26, 2019
Topics:
ui
<p>the pros and cons of ghost buttons </p>
↗
https://www.smashingmagazine.com/2018/01/ghost-button-design/
Aline Silveira
Jun 26, 2019
Topics:
ui
<p>a few different uses for tooltips </p>
↗
https://www.appcues.com/blog/tooltips
Aline Silveira
Jun 26, 2019
Topics:
<p>Open Source Repository Linter </p>
↗
https://github.com/todogroup/repolinter
João Lins
Jun 26, 2019
Topics:
open source, tool
<p>Bringing A Healthy Code Review Mindset To Your Team </p>
↗
https://www.smashingmagazine.com/2019/06/bringing-healthy-code-review-mindset/
Felipe Farias
Jun 25, 2019
Topics:
<p>GraphQL: The Documentary (Official Release) </p>
↗
https://www.youtube.com/watch?v=783ccP__No8
João Lins
Jun 25, 2019
Topics:
graphql
<p>Web Availability Tool by region: Useful if a particular region is affected by downtimes </p>
↗
https://www.uptrends.com/tools/uptime
João Lins
Jun 25, 2019
Topics:
availability, tool
<p>A long list of (advanced) JavaScript questions, and their explanations </p>
↗
https://github.com/lydiahallie/javascript-questions
Felipe Farias
Jun 25, 2019
Topics:
js
<p>Why ['1', '7', '11'].map(parseInt) returns [1, NaN, 3] in Javascript </p>
↗
https://medium.com/dailyjs/parseint-mystery-7c4368ef7b21
Mariane Pastor
Jun 25, 2019
Topics:
js
<p>dealing with color in design systems </p>
↗
https://medium.com/eightshapes-llc/color-in-design-systems-a1c80f65fa3
Aline Silveira
Jun 25, 2019
Topics:
design system, tools, ui
<p>A conversation about the DRY principle: </p>
↗
https://therabbithole.libsyn.com/113-the-dry-principal-is-misunderstood-with-steven-solomon
Rebeca Sarai
Jun 25, 2019
Topics:
dry, podcast
<p>Webhint is a linting tool that will help you with your site’s accessibility, speed, security and more, by checking your code for best practices and common errors. </p>
↗
https://webhint.io/
Felipe Farias
Jun 25, 2019
Topics:
<p>Use the Rule of 100 to determine wether to represent discounts on a product price tag with percentages (20% off) or absolute values ($20 off) </p>
↗
https://www.thegreatcoursesdaily.com/the-rule-of-100/
Pedro Bacelar
Jun 19, 2019
Topics:
design, e-commerce, sales, ux
<p>High performance and SEO friendly lazy loader </p>
↗
https://github.com/aFarkas/lazysizes
Tiago Costa
Jun 19, 2019
Topics:
<p>hiring great people is not all it takes to build a great team. here are a few solid strategies: </p>
↗
https://www.nytimes.com/guides/business/manage-a-successful-team
Aline Silveira
Jun 19, 2019
Topics:
leadership, management
Previous
Next
Clients
Services
Blog
About Us
Careers
Let's talk